Experience the Enduring Magic of Herman's Hermits & Peter Noone
Herman's Hermits, fronted by the charismatic Peter Noone, rose to global superstardom in the mid-1960s as a pivotal part of the British Invasion. Their catchy melodies, infectious pop-rock sound, and boy-next-door image quickly captivated audiences worldwide. With an astonishing string of hits, including "I'm Into Something Good," "Mrs. Brown, You've Got a Lovely Daughter," "Henry VIII, I Am," "Can't You Hear My Heartbeat," and "There's a Kind of Hush," Herman's Hermits became a household name, selling millions of records and charming fans with their live performances. Peter Noone's distinctive vocals and engaging stage presence have remained the heart and soul of the group throughout its illustrious career. The current lineup continues to faithfully deliver the classic sound that fans adore, ensuring that the spirit of the sixties lives on with every chord and lyric. Lillian S. Wells Hall at The Parker: A Fort Lauderdale Gem
The Lillian S. Wells Hall at The Parker in Fort Lauderdale, Florida, provides an exquisite backdrop for an artist of Herman's Hermits' caliber. Originally opened in 1967, The Parker, formerly known simply as Parker Playhouse, is a true mid-century modern architectural marvel that has recently undergone a stunning, multi-million-dollar renovation. This revitalization has preserved its classic charm while enhancing it with state-of-the-art sound and lighting systems, comfortable seating, and an overall elevated patron experience. Located conveniently in Fort Lauderdale, The Parker is celebrated for its intimate atmosphere, where every seat offers excellent sightlines and acoustics, ensuring that the nuances of Herman's Hermits' music will be heard with crystal clarity.
